Application
ML240 has been used as an inhibitor of D2 ATPase activity of valosin-containing protein.

| Kingdom | Organic compounds |
|---|---|
| Superclass | Organoheterocyclic compounds |
| Class | Diazanaphthalenes |
| Subclass | Benzodiazines |
| Intermediate Tree Nodes | Quinazolines |
| Direct Parent | Quinazolinamines |
| Alternative Parents | Benzimidazoles Benzylamines Anisoles Aminopyrimidines and derivatives Alkyl aryl ethers N-substituted imidazoles Imidolactams Aminoimidazoles Heteroaromatic compounds Azacyclic compounds Primary amines Hydrocarbon derivatives |
| Molecular Framework | Aromatic heteropolycyclic compounds |
| Substituents | Quinazolinamine - Benzimidazole - Anisole - Phenol ether - Benzylamine - Alkyl aryl ether - Aminopyrimidine - Aminoimidazole - Monocyclic benzene moiety - Imidolactam - Benzenoid - Pyrimidine - N-substituted imidazole - Heteroaromatic compound - Azole - Imidazole - Azacycle - Ether - Organooxygen compound - Primary amine - Amine - Organic nitrogen compound - Hydrocarbon derivative - Organic oxygen compound - Organonitrogen compound - Aromatic heteropolycyclic compound |
| Description | This compound belongs to the class of organic compounds known as quinazolinamines. These are heterocyclic aromatic compounds containing a quianazoline moiety substituted by one or more amine groups. |
